Side A
Oxen Ploughing - Collected from Adam Landry of Trebartha, near Callington, Cornwall , in 1890 by Sabine Baring-Gould
Rosemary Lane - Collected by Sabine Baring-Gould and published in 1989-92
The Laurel Bush/The Salamanca Reel - Two reels from the Irish tradition
Tarry Trousers - An unusual tune for this version from Sharp's manuscripts
The Luck Penny Jig/The Hag with the Money
Do me Ama - Learnt from A.L.Lloyd
Side B
The Blacksmith 
King Henry my Son - Collected in Cumberland in the early years of the twentieth century
Drimin Donn Dillish/Moving Clouds 
Death and the Lady - A version from Roger Hannaford of Lower Widdecombe, Dartmoor - from the Baring-Gould papers
My Darling Asleep/Will you come home with me
Brisk young Batchelor - Collected by Cecil Sharp
Greenland Bound - from A.L.Lloyd
